Naval weapons of World War One

Friedman, Norman, 1946-2011
Books
Between 1914 and 1918 weapons development was both rapid and complex, so this text has two functions: on the one hand it details all the guns, torpedoes, mines, aerial bombs and anti-submarine systems employed during that period; but it also seeks to explain the background to their evolution.
